EUT20 Belgium Cricket League Launches with Zaheer Khan as Co-Owner
The EUT20 Belgium Cricket League has announced its inaugural season with former World Cup winner Zaheer Khan joining as a co-owner of the Antwerp Anchors franchise, signaling a major push to establish professional franchise cricket in continental Europe.
The league is scheduled to run from June 6 to June 14, 2026, across Belgium with six city-based franchises sanctioned by the Belgian Cricket Federation. Zaheer Khan brings significant global credibility to the Antwerp Anchors, while West Indies star Andre Russell has been confirmed as a player to attract international audiences. The tournament aims to bridge the gap between Europe's existing cricket communities and the global professional landscape through a centralized structure that manages operations and media rights.
This initiative aims to fill a gap in the global cricket map by introducing a structured, professional T20 league in Europe, leveraging star power and existing local passion to build a long-term pathway for the sport's growth on the continent.
